The braking methods of three-phase asynchronous motor mainly include the following:

Energy Consumption Braking : This method is consumed by converting the mechanical energy of the electric motor into heat energy or other forms of energy. Energy consumption braking devices, braking resistors and electromagnetic brakes are commonly used energy consumption braking equipment.

Reverse braking: By changing the phase sequence of the power supply of the motor, the motor produces torque opposite to the original direction of rotation, so as to achieve rapid stopping. This method has a large braking torque, but a large energy consumption.

Regenerative braking: In some cases, the electric motor can recycle energy by feeding the generated electrical energy back into the grid through the inverter. This method requires special inverter support.
